ELEANOR LAING


'Eleanor Fulton Laing', née Pritchard, (born 1 February 1958, Paisley) is a British politician. She is Conservative Member of Parliament for Epping Forest, and was first elected in 1997. Currently she serves as Shadow Minister for Women.
Laing contested Paisley North in the 1987 general election. When Laing was first elected to the Epping Forest seat in 1997, the seat had been made a marginal by the Labour landslide. In 2001 the seat returned to safe status with a 19.8% majority. In 2005, she increased that majority to 32%. She has an interest in education, transport, economic policy, constitution and devolution.
Laing has one son, born in 2001. She was divorced in 2002.

Past and Present Positions


1999-2000 Opposition whip

2000-2001 Opposition spokesperson, constitutional affairs

2001-2003 Spokeswoman for education and skills

2003-2004 Opposition spokesman, home, constitutional and legal affairs

2005 Shadow secretary of state for Scotland

2004 Shadow minister for Women & Equality

★ '2007- Shadow Junior Justice Minister'
